Position Overview:
We are currently seeking a Pharmacy Technician to support our clinical team by assisting with medication-related tasks and ensuring an exceptional patient experience. This role is ideal for someone who is detail-oriented, proactive, and passionate about helping patients navigate their healthcare needs.
Key Responsibilities:
Deliver excellent customer service to patients, providers, and pharmacy partners
Process medication refill requests and prior authorizations using the Electronic Medical Record (EMR) system
Assist patients in accessing pharmaceutical assistance programs
Maintain, monitor, and track the dispensing of on-site medication samples
Build and maintain relationships with pharmaceutical representatives
Field incoming calls from pharmacies to provide prescription clarifications, refill authorizations, and medication interaction support
Respond to patient phone calls regarding medication questions, concerns, or messages for the provider
Perform general administrative duties as requested by physicians and office managers
Qualifications:
High school diploma or equivalent required
Active Pharmacy Technician license (must be maintained in good standing)
Solid knowledge of pharmaceutical principles, medical terminology, and insurance payor requirements
Excellent communication skills and a welcoming, patient-first attitude
Ability to work both independently and as part of a collaborative team
Willingness to travel to satellite offices as needed
